New York City Mayor Zohran Mamdani spoke out after releasing more than 170,000 pages of undisclosed city records to the public ahead of the 25th anniversary of the September 11 terror attacks that prove city officials knew that the air was "toxic" around Ground Zero during recovery efforts.

Documents reviewed by the New York Times before their release indicate that asbestos concentrations in dust collected throughout the area exceeded hazardous thresholds in the days after the World Trade Center collapsed. Testing also found asbestos and other contaminants in the air and dust at levels considered unsafe.

After speaking during the “Steel Across America” event put on by the Tunnel to Towers Foundation, President Donald Trump was criticized for lamenting that one hero of the September 11 terror attacks is "more famous" than him.

Trump was referring to Welles Crowther, an equities trader at Sandler O’Neill & Partners who was working in the South Tower on Sept. 11, 2001. Crowther, who became known for wearing a red bandana, helped evacuate people from the building and is credited with saving at least 18 lives before the tower collapsed.
